How is the Utica, NE housing market right now?

The median home sale price in Utica, NE is $319,644. Homes sell in an average of 2 days. The market is currently a seller's market. (Source: Redfin monthly MLS data, as of March 2026 — the most recent Redfin release; Redfin publishes each month's data on a ~6-week lag.)

What is it like to live in Utica?

Utica is a community of approximately 1K residents with a median age of 35.1 years.The median household income is $81,797, which reflects a relatively affluent area with strong earning potential. 21.7% of residents hold a bachelor's degree or higher, showing a mixed educational demographic.

Homeownership rates are at 71.6%, reflecting strong community stability and long-term resident commitment. The average commute time is 19.8 minutes, which makes this an excellent choice for those seeking short commutes to employment centers.Overall, Utica offers a balanced lifestyle with accessible home values relative to local income levels.
